How the client came to consult a Suwon narcotics attorney
The account of the client who urgently sought the attorney's assistance is as follows.
The client decided to purchase methamphetamine from a drug seller who operated a Telegram drug channel.
He purchased the drugs by receiving, via Telegram from an unidentified seller, the location of the “drop” and retrieving the methamphetamine behind a building.
The client even administered the purchased methamphetamine by dissolving it in water and drinking it.

2. Statutes related to the case explained by a Suwon narcotics attorney
Under Article 60 (Penal Provisions) of the Narcotics Control Act, a person who commits any of the following acts may be punished by imprisonment for up to 10 years or a fine of up to 100 million won.
▶ A person who illegally trades in, arranges, receives, possesses, owns, uses, manages, dispenses, administers, or provides psychotropic drugs
▶ A person who issues a prescription listing psychotropic drugs
In other words, violating the law concerning psychotropic drugs can result in very severe punishment, so caution is required.

① ADHD Symptoms
The client did not administer drugs for the purpose of mere curiosity or pleasure.
The client, who had been suffering from symptoms of ADHD, had heard somewhere that the components of methamphetamine were helpful in treatment and wanted to check whether they would have an effect in improving the symptoms.
The client emphasized that the client came to commit the offense in this case in the course of making efforts, in the client's own way, to treat the client's mental illness.
② Confession and Remorse
Although the client took the drug for the purpose of treatment, the fact that this constituted an unlawful act was undeniable, and so the client confessed to the entire offense from the investigation stage.
The client emphasized that he was firmly resolved never to commit the same wrong again and that he was making efforts to fundamentally treat his mental illness.
③ Low Likelihood of Reoffending
When the client took the purchased drug, far from the symptoms improving, the client only felt nauseous and dizzy, and came to realize that it was of no help whatsoever.
Accordingly, the client emphasized that the client has no thought whatsoever of wanting to use drugs again, and that there is no possibility of reoffending at all.
4. The court's determination on the Suwon narcotics attorney's arguments
The court, accepting the arguments of the Suwon narcotics attorney, rendered the following judgment: ‘The defendant shall be sentenced to ten months of imprisonment. However, the execution of the above sentence shall be suspended for three years from the date this judgment becomes final.’
